Perhaps Ask Product Hunt will be useful for this. πŸ˜‰ But seriously, Twitter is great for this. Search for your competitors name to see what people are saying or asking. If you need to dig deeper, consider tweeting at them to setup a conversation over email or video call to learn more. If this is helpful, consider using Tweetdeck. I see nearly every Product Hunt mention on Twitter, giving me a pulse of what people are sharing, talking about, and asking. The same can be done for your competitors.
